A company uses AWS Organizations and has AWS CloudTrail enabled in all Regions. A security engineer must ensure CloudTrail cannot be disabled. Which solution meets this requirement?

Correct answer: Create a service control policy (SCP) with an explicit Deny for the StopLogging and DeleteTrail actions. Attach the SCP to the root OU..
Why this is the answer
The correct solution is to create a Service Control Policy (SCP) with an explicit Deny for the StopLogging and DeleteTrail actions and attach it to the root OU. SCPs are a feature of AWS Organizations that allow you to centrally manage permissions for all accounts in your organization. An explicit Deny in an SCP overrides any Allow permissions, even those granted by an administrator, effectively preventing anyone in any member account from stopping or deleting CloudTrail trails. Enabling CloudTrail log file integrity validation ensures logs haven't been tampered with, but doesn't prevent trails from being disabled. Enabling SSE-KMS encrypts logs but doesn't prevent their deletion or stopping the trail. Creating IAM policies for users to prevent DescribeTrails and GetTrailStatus only restricts viewing trail status, not disabling it, and would need to be applied to every user, which is not scalable or comprehensive enough.
